LG's new Sound Suite is not just another soundbar package. It is a deliberate rethinking of how home audio should exist within the spaces we actually inhabit. Centered on the H7 soundbar and accompanied by wireless M7 and M5 surrounds alongside the W7 subwoofer, this system moves away from the traditional home theater installation mindset. Instead, it treats sound as furniture: modular, portable, and designed to evolve alongside your living environment. The real innovation lies in Dolby Atmos FlexConnect. Rather than demanding precise, tape-measured speaker placements, the technology analyzes your room and calibrates itself based on wherever you choose to position the components. Awkward outlet locations, asymmetrical layouts, rental constraints: these are no longer obstacles to work around, just variables the system absorbs. When paired with LG's forthcoming televisions and AI-driven tuning, Sound Suite signals a shift in where premium audio is headed. Not a static black box anchored beneath your screen, but an adaptive sonic layer that quietly contours itself to your space, your habits, and your aesthetic preferences.
